Company announcement

Harvest NYC Inc is recalling 200g packages of Enoki Mushroom due to potential contamination with Listeria monocytogenes.

The recalled mushrooms were distributed nationwide in retail stores.

No illnesses have been reported to date in connection with this problem.

Consumers who purchased the product between January 11, 2025 and January 31, 2025 are urged to destroy or return them for a full refund.

Risk:

Listeria monocytogenes can cause serious and sometimes fatal infections in young children, frail or elderly people and others with weakened immune systems. In healthy persons, it may cause short-term symptoms such as high fever, severe headache, stiffness, nausea, abdominal pain, and diarrhea. Listeria infection can cause miscarriages and stillbirths among pregnant women.

Impacted states: Nationwide

Products:

- Enoki Mushroom (UPC code(s): 6975730520101)
